Government Description
Joystick, data entry. This award includes the supply of various motor vehicle parts from jlg industries, such as joysticks for data entry, alternators, battery boxes, belts, windshield wiper blades, circuit card assemblies, compressors, control assemblies, doors, exhaust pipes, filters, floodlights, lift truck forks, headlights, horns, hose assemblies, hydraulic motors, mufflers, pedal assemblies, quick release pins, radiators, seats, switches, tires and wheels, transmission parts, valves, weldments, windows, windshield washer assemblies, and wiring harnesses for use by the Army and Marine Corps.

JLG Industries was awarded Indefinite Delivery Contract SPE7LX21D0120 (SPE7LX-21-D-0120) by DLA Land and Maritime for Joystick, Data Entry Contract in July 2021. The IDC has a duration of 5 years and was awarded through solicitation Vehicle Parts from JLG Industries full & open with NAICS 336211 and PSC 4910 via direct negotiation acquisition procedures with 1 bid received. To date, $6,037,171 has been obligated through this vehicle. The total ceiling is $17,660,836, of which 34% has been used.

DOD Announcements

Jun 2021: JLG Industries Inc., McConnellsburg, Pennsylvania, has been awarded a maximum $8,992,585 firm-fixed-price, indefinite-delivery contract for motor vehicle parts. This was a competitive acquisition with one response received. This is a three-year base contract with two one-year option periods. Locations of performance are Pennsylvania and Wisconsin, with a June 7, 2024, performance completion date. Using military services are Army and Marine Corps. Type of appropriation is fiscal 2021 through 2024 defense working capital funds. The contracting activity is the Defense Logistics Agency Land and Maritime, Columbus, Ohio (SPE7LX-21-D-0120).
